Croft - photo opportunities ??

Hiya all! Surely one of you smart people can help me here - I am making the journey to Croft for next months BTCC rounds there, have only been there once before, in 2002, and in my last visit didn't explore much of the circuit.

My question is, can you get right around the back of the circuit(ie Jim Clark Esses, Barcroft etc..) to take pictures or is it closed to the general public? Also, any tips on any good points to snap away on the circuit ??

If you have a look at this map HERE it does not list any viewing areas around the Jim Clark Esses or Barcroft. If you want to see what the view is like from the disabled car park along the back straight between the chicane and Tower bend have a look at the motorsport pages at my site, there are a few galleries from Croft all taken from that straight.
Around Clervaux and Hawthorn there is a fence to shoot through or you can sit up on the hill but you would need a long lens, you also have the "grandstand" at Clervaux but I have never sat there.

Tower throught to Sunny Out is all closed off to the public.

You can get a decent side-on shot from the public area between Sunny and the Complex. The bank is fairly high and other than a few poles for the PA speaker there's no high fence or any other obstructions.

Exit of Hawthorn isn't too bad, either stand with your nose against the fence and try to focus it out or if you can find a spot there's a small grass bank a little further back.

Another good side-on place is between the Chicane and Tower, although the background isn't as good. If you walk all the way to Tower you can just about get a rearward facing shot of the cars going over the apex.
